Our Mission

The Education Special Interest Group (EdSIG) is focused on advancing microbiology educators and supporting scholarship of teaching and learning in microbiology.

ASM full logo large.jpg

The main purposes of EdSIG are to:

  • Foster networks, collaborations and professional development opportunities for educators at various stages in their career, in microbiology and the related sciences.

  • Promote microbiology education in Australia and enhance awareness of microbiology in the wider community.
